An unlicensed property manager can do all of the following except: Maintenance Showing units Negotiating lease terms Furnishing

published information
Business
1 answer:
Lynna [10]2 years ago
6 0

When a person is an unlicensed property manager, they can do all of the above except Negotiating lease terms.

<h3>What can an unlicensed property manager do?</h3>

An unlicensed property manager can show prospective buyers the units on sale as well as maintaining the units. They can also furnish people with published information on the units.

They cannot however, negotiate lease terms with people because they do not have the license and authority to do so.
